Frederick D. Shelton collection 1928

Campaign literature and clippings, relating to the 1928 campaign for the Republican Presidential nomination.

1 manuscript box; (0.4 linear feet)

Herbert Clark Hoover (b. August 10, 1874, Iowa-d. October 20, 1964), thirty-first president of the United States, was born in Iowa, and was orphaned as a child. A Quaker known from his childhood as "Bert" to his friends, he began a career as a mining engineer soon after graduating from Stanford University in 1895.
